The DBT JRF (Junior Research Fellowship) program invite applications for the Biotechnology Eligibility Test (BET) conducted by the Department of Biotechnology (DBT). Biotechnology students of M.Sc./M. Tech or M.V.Sc can apply for the fellowship eligibility test. The DBT JRF scheme will provide the research fellows up to INR 28,000 monthly.

The fellowship program is being organized by the Department of Biotechnology and coordinated by the Biotech Consortium India Limited (BCIL). As the DBT indicates, around 1,000 students benefit from the DBT- JRF Scheme in various Universities or Institutes. The last date to apply for the DBT JRF fellowship still needs to be updated. DBT Junior Research Fellowship Eligibility Criteria

List of eligibility conditions for the DBT research fellowship are given below:

  • The applicant must have a degree in M.Sc./M.Tech or M.V.Sc. with Biotechnology as specialization from any University or Institute recognized under UGC/AICTE.
  • For general and OBC category, the applicant must have secured a minimum of 60 percent marks or equivalent grade.
  • For SC/ST/PH category, a minimum of 55 percent marks is required to be eligible for the DBT-JRF scheme.
  • Candidates with a maximum age of (general-28, OBC-non creamy layer-31, SC/ST/PH and women- 33) as on the last date of application (22 March) are eligible to apply.

Note: To apply for the fellowship, the applicant must have qualified M.Sc./M.Tech/ M.V.Sc. degree with Biotechnology as specialization. Eligible subjects under the fellowship scheme are as follows:

  • Agricultural, Animal/Veterinary, Bio-resources Biotechnology, Biochemical Engineering, Biosciences and Biotechnology, Medical, Marine, Industrial, Environmental, Pharmaceutical, Food, and Bioinformatics.

DBT Junior Research Fellowship Rewards and Benefits

The three-year fellowship will be extended to 2 more years based on the academic performance of the candidate and shall be upgraded to Senior Research fellow by the end of the second year.

  • Selected fellows will be awarded with INR 25,000/28,000 per month.
  • INR 30,000 is provided under house rent allowance (HRA). This allowance can be provisional with respect to the DST guidelines and research contingency.

DBT Junior Research Fellowship Selection Process

  • All candidates will be selected based on the Biotechnology Eligibility Test or BET examination.
  • Following the merit, eligible research fellows for the DBT-JRF program are selected under two categories.

Category I Fellowship

  • Top 275 fellows from the selected candidates can register for Ph.D. in any recognised University or Institute in India.

Category II Students

  • The next 100 candidates can join in any projects sponsored by the Department of Biotechnology. They can avail fellowship from the project proportional to NET OR GATE qualification based on DST guidelines.

Note: Fellows from the DBT-JRF program will not be considered for the selection in Category II.

Biotechnology Eligibility Test

All eligible applicants must appear for the Online Biotechnology Eligibility Test (BET) in order to avail the fellowship.

  • Attending the DBT- BET- JRF examination is mandatory for all applicants as the online test will be conducted in any one of the three cities selected by the candidate while applying.
  • Candidates can apply for the fellowship only through registering for the BET exam and the last date of application is on 23rd.
  • The BET application fee is INR 1000 for General and OBC candidates were applicants SC/ST/PH category can pay INR 250 as application fee.

BET Exam Centers

New Delhi, Bangalore, Chandigarh, Lucknow, Patna, Trivandrum and Ahmedabad Kolkata, Guwahati, Hyderabad, Chennai, Pune.

Note: Travel allowance or any kind of allowance will not be granted to any applicant for attending the test.
